In 2022, a company calling itself “Hyundai Global Motors” won a share of India’s flagship battery-manufacturing incentive. It had no real connection to Hyundai. The capacity it forfeited is only now, in 2026, finally going back out to tender.

Must Know
- The Union Cabinet approved the Production Linked Incentive (PLI) Scheme for Advanced Chemistry Cell (ACC) Battery Storage in May 2021. Its outlay is ₹18,100 crore.
- The scheme targets 50 GWh of domestic ACC manufacturing capacity. It aims to cut India’s dependence on imported battery cells, mostly from China.
- The Ministry of Heavy Industries (MHI) administers the scheme. Incentives are disbursed over five years, tied to actual sales of batteries manufactured in India.
- The scheme is technology-agnostic. Beneficiary companies can choose their own cell chemistry and manufacturing technology.
- In March 2022, four companies were awarded the full 50 GWh: Rajesh Exports (5 GWh), Ola Electric Mobility (20 GWh), Reliance New Energy Solar (5 GWh), and Hyundai Global Motors (20 GWh).
- On 15 July 2026, MHI released a Global Tender for the last 10 GWh of capacity. This tranche is earmarked for Grid-Scale Stationary Storage (GSSS) applications.
- Bidding uses a two-stage Quality and Cost Based Selection (QCBS) process on the Central Public Procurement (CPP) Portal. Bids are due 13 October 2026.
Good to Know
- “Hyundai Global Motors,” awarded 20 GWh in 2022, had no real connection to Hyundai Motor Company. The genuine Hyundai publicly disclaimed the firm in August 2022.
- Hyundai Global Motors voluntarily withdrew from the scheme that November. Its 20 GWh became available for reallocation.
- Of that freed capacity, Reliance New Energy Solar later received an additional 10 GWh, taking its total award to 15 GWh. The remaining 10 GWh was set aside for grid-scale storage, at the request of the Ministry of New and Renewable Energy (MNRE).
- As of July 2026, 40 GWh of the original 50 GWh target had been awarded to domestic manufacturers. This new tender covers the remaining 10 GWh.
- The scheme is expected to draw around ₹45,000 crore in direct investment. It could also help save ₹2,00,000 to ₹2,50,000 crore on India’s oil import bill, through EV adoption over the scheme’s life.
- The ACC PLI scheme runs alongside the PLI Scheme for Automobile and Auto Components (₹25,938 crore) and the FAME scheme (₹10,000 crore). Together, they support India’s shift to electric vehicles.
- Progress has lagged behind the original targets. As of October 2025, independent analysis found only about 2.8% of the target capacity, roughly 1.4 GWh, had actually been commissioned, entirely by Ola Electric.

Great to Know
- The Hyundai Global Motors episode is a real case study in tender due diligence. A bidder can clear a competitive government screening process and still misrepresent its own identity.
- “Awarded” capacity and “commissioned” capacity are different things worth telling apart. A company can be allotted GWh on paper years before any of it is actually built and running.

- The 10 GWh Grid-Scale Stationary Storage tranche reflects a wider shift in priorities. As India’s renewable energy share grows, storing that power matters as much as powering electric vehicles.

Current Affairs
- On 17 July 2026, DST-affiliated researchers unveiled an ultrafast organic anode material for next-generation batteries. It reached 80% charge in just over one minute, while holding up well over repeated charge cycles. (Source: PIB)
- The material, a covalent organic framework (COF), came from a joint team at IACS and the S.N. Bose National Centre for Basic Sciences, led by Dr. Urmimala Maitra and Dr. Pradip Pachfule. (Source: PIB)
- The same COF material can also store sodium ions, not just lithium. This opens a path toward cheaper sodium-ion batteries, alongside faster-charging lithium-ion cells. (Source: PIB)
- On 29 July 2026, MHI held the pre-bid conference for the 10 GWh ACC Grid-Scale Stationary Storage tender, at India Habitat Centre, New Delhi. More than 30 prospective bidders attended, alongside NITI Aayog, MNRE, and the Ministry of Power. (Source: PIB)
- Bidders’ last date to submit further queries by email is 20 August 2026. (Source: PIB)
- 15 July 2026: The Ministry of Heavy Industries released a Global Tender inviting bids for the final 10 GWh of ACC manufacturing capacity, earmarked for Grid-Scale Stationary Storage. (Source: PIB)
- 15 July 2026: Tender documents became available the same day. The pre-bid conference is set for 29 July 2026, with bids due 13 October and technical bids opening 14 October. (Source: PIB)
- 15 July 2026: The same release confirmed that 40 GWh of the scheme’s original 50 GWh target has been awarded to domestic manufacturers to date. (Source: PIB)
